I really enjoyed this series, even if (though I'm Argentinian) I've never been a hardcore fan of Fito Paez or Argentinian music in general. That being said, I love a lot of that music and I know a lot of it very well, as I grew up listening to it and it's part of my culture and it's burned in me, it brings back beautiful memories.
On my forties now, and living abroad for almost half of my life, I wish I was a part of all that, watching this series made me quite melancholic and that's pure merit of the production value which is outstanding. The costume and settings design is excellent, and the attention to detail lifts up the experience really high.
Knowing the musicians that appear in the story and the melodies and songs that Fito plays even in their early stages of development is something that probably Argentinians will enjoy the most, but even someone that doesn't know the characters could get interested in researching further into these music legends of our country and find some of these gems which probably are not known internationally.
As mentioned before, the cinematography (I'm a photographer/cinematographer, so I get quite technical in this aspect when I watch) is absolutely beautiful, it's really one of the best aspects of the show, really high standards for a "TV series"!!
And again, I felt very touched throughout the episodes, which speaks of good writing, so another great achievement there!
I have to say, some times the performances were uneven, mostly from the main character Fito (played by Ivan Hochman) who felt a bit overacted by moments, but I understand the real Fito has some special, intense body language (even for an Argentinean!) and that can be a huge challenge! Still, it's not something that ruined the show and the physical resemblance really helped. Specially Micaela Riera as Fabiana Cantilo, incredible resemblance!!
Overall an excellent show, I really enjoyed it and I'm really looking forward to see more Argentinian artists brought into more series of this quality.
Well done all the team, and thank you for bringing me back home.
